About The HotelFriendly and comfortable property located in a pedestrian street of the historic and touristic Latin Quarter and Notre-Dame area.
Close to the Seine River, Saint-Louis Island, Sorbonne University, Luxembourg Garden and the typical Saint-Germain-des-Près, you will really feel you are amidst everything Parisian.
Easy to reach from the airports and near most historical monuments, this hotel has the ingredients for a pleasant stay. Staff at the reception will help you with tours and restaurant reservations. Public parking is at your disposal.
Hotel Europe Saint Severin is situated in the Quartier Latin, along a pedestrian road, on the corner of the streets Rue Saint Severin and the Rue de la Harpe.
The hotel is decorated in the renowned Hausmann-style from the beginning of the 20th century, with lots of natural stone. Rooms are being refurnished to create a new modern style.
The Hotel has it own restaurant, Rim Café, with a comfortable terrace where you can enjoy your dinner in summer and spring time.

Public Transport:
The hotel is situated in the heart of Paris near the metro station Saint Michel. It is served by metro line 4 and RER B and C which go directly from Orly and Charles de Gaulle airports. Buses 21, 24, 27, 38, 63, 85 and 96 stop not far away.
By Eurostar:
If you are coming from London via the Eurostar, Gare du Nord, Gare de l'Est, and Gare Montparnasse are connected to Metro line 4 which goes directly to Saint Michel station.
When you leave the metro station, walk to Boulevard Saint Michel. Rue Saint Séverin will be the second street on your left.
By Car:
- Enter Paris by Porte d'Orléans.
- Take Boulevard Général Leclerc, Boulevard Raspail, Boulevard Saint Germain and Boulevard Saint Michel.
- Rue Saint Séverin is near the River Seine. |
